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
825 703957735 460869
650842822 25693191 89912808961
650842822 25693191 89912808961
947014 0376012 32
All about undefined
Interested in learning more?
650842822 25693191 89912808961
947014 0376012 32
See more
85 0902
9955 960 41767462498
See more
3257700117 3444698
5897790 9852940 219435 01
See more